Youth Seminar 'Atzolys' in Kārsava Focuses on Latgalian Language and Culture

This week, a youth seminar called 'Atzolys' is taking place in Kārsava, where participants explore the Latgalian language and culture. The event is expected to culminate in the creation of a new game in Latgalian.

This week, Kārsava Secondary School and its surroundings have become a place where Latgalian can be heard frequently. A youth seminar under the name 'Atzolys'—meaning 'young shoots'—is being held there. The event encourages participants to explore Latgalian cultural values and social processes, while also offering an opportunity to connect with other young people.

The seminar is not just about meeting new people and sharing the joy of being together. It is also a chance to become better acquainted with the Latgalian language and culture. In a relaxed, non-formal atmosphere, participants can practice the language and learn more about the traditions and identity of the Latgalian region. For many young people, this is a way to strengthen their ties to the local cultural heritage.

The plans for this year's 'Atzolys' include a tangible creative outcome: the creation of a new game in Latgalian. By working on the game, participants will be able to put their language skills into practice and contribute to the promotion of Latgalian. Once completed, the game could serve as a useful tool for spreading the Latgalian language among a wider audience, especially among young people. Thus, the seminar aims to combine cultural learning with hands-on creativity.
